Skip to main content

Featured cabin destinations

Destination inspiration for your trip – find a cabin

The best cabins in Ratnapura District

Check out our pick of great cabins in Ratnapura District

Filter by:


Review score

Superb: 9+ Very good: 8+ Good: 7+ Pleasant: 6+
Our top picks Lowest price first Star rating and price Top reviewed

See the latest prices and deals by choosing your dates.

Featuring a swimming pool, a garden, a restaurant and views of the garden, Maika safari lodge is located in Udawalawe and provides accommodation with free WiFi.

There is a fully equipped private bathroom with shower and free toiletries. Great accommodation, great food and very good tour of Udawalawe National Park. swimming pool was incredible.

Show more Show less
9.2
Superb
297 reviews
Price from
US$7.68
per night

Located in Udawalawe in the Ratnapura District region, Wild River Side provides accommodation with free WiFi and free private parking, as well as access to a hot tub.

Udawalawe National Park is 15 km from Wild River Side. Mattala Rajapaksa International Airport is 52 km away, and the property offers a paid airport shuttle service. Very calm location on edge of the jungle. Lovely large rooms with ac and a terrace. Well maintained and Samira the owner was very helpful. He will organise a safari if you want.

Show more Show less
9.5
Exceptional
112 reviews
Price from
US$11.40
per night

With Udawalawe National Park reachable in 14 km, Lizard Safari Lodge provides accommodation, a restaurant, a garden, a shared lounge and a bar. The lodge features both WiFi and private parking free of charge.

Mattala Rajapaksa International Airport is 53 km away, and the property offers a free airport shuttle service. The accommodation was perfect. We were even able to change rooms without any problems and the family who owned it was very nice. They kept looking after our son so that we could eat in peace. It's really worth stopping there and enjoying the extraordinary hospitality. Simply top!

Show more Show less
9.3
Superb
112 reviews
Price from
US$42.75
per night

Set in Udawalawe in the Ratnapura District region, EMERALD HAVEN SAFARI Cottages offers accommodation with free private parking.

There is a private bathroom with shower in every unit, along with free toiletries, a hairdryer and slippers. The place was just better than we expected for this price. Large very comfortable room. And the food served at the place (dinner and breakfast) was carefully prepared and delicious. Ideal place to stay if visiting National safari park. Good value for money.

Show more Show less
10
Exceptional
27 reviews
Price from
US$3.24
per night

Boasting garden views, Ivory Safari Lodge offers accommodation with an outdoor swimming pool and a terrace, around 16 km from Udawalawe National Park. Beauty services is available for guests. The accommodation features a 24-hour front desk, airport transfers, full-day security and free WiFi. Extremely friendly hosts, really clean room, good service, tasty food. We got a magnificent safari trip organized by the hotel, treated like the family

Show more Show less
9.6
Exceptional
54 reviews
Price from
US$7.67
per night

Located 12 km from Udawalawe National Park, Peacock Riverside Eco Lodge provides accommodation with a garden, a restaurant and room service for your convenience.

Some units include a terrace and/or a balcony with river views. A green and beautifully run guest house where we really like to stay. The owners were some of the kindest people we met and went out of their way to give us advice and a smile! The owners talk to us very well. Dinner was perfect, very romantic and delicious buffet. We also booked a safari through them which we love, it was just the two of us in the jeep and we saw more elephants with a knowledgeable driver ( sujee ) .Definitely getting old. Thank you for your wonderful hospitality

Show more Show less
9.4
Superb
21 reviews
Price from
US$15
per night

Providing mountain views, Rosewood Manor in Botiyatenna provides accommodation, free bikes, a fitness centre, a garden, a shared lounge and a terrace. Both WiFi and private parking are available at the lodge free of charge. We were a family of five with adult children and had the whole villa for ourselves, and the experience was amazing! The villa is newly built and everything felt brand new but yet very familiar with Ishan heading a super attentive and nice staff. The views are breathtaking over the surrounding mountains, with a small river pond on the property to take a refreshing dip into (together with the small fish givning you a interesting fish spa experience). We just felt blessed staying in this tranquille environment, enjoying excellent food and just hanging out together. It was definitely more than worth the bumpy ride up to this place. Big thanks to Ishan with staff that made this an extraordinary experience.

Show more Show less
9.5
Exceptional
10 reviews
Price from
US$240
per night

Situated 14 km from Udawalawe National Park, suncity privacy cottages features accommodation with a garden, a bar and free shuttle service for your convenience. Complimentary WiFi is available.

Fitted with a terrace, the units offer air conditioning and feature a flat-screen TV and a private bathroom with bidet and free toiletries. For added convenience, the property can provide towels and bed linen for an extra charge. This place is INCREDIBLE!! Kasun the owner is one of the nicest guys ever - so kind, helpful and goes above and beyond to assist in every need. Watermelon on arrival, fresh coconut on departure, organised safari, prepared yummy breakfast included in the price, relaxed check out timing....the list goes on! The villa was stunning, way better than the pictures. The garden is stunning and my son loved running around discovering all the plants, wildlife and fruits. Do not hesitate to book - would book again without a doubt. Thank you so much Kasun ❤️

Show more Show less
9.7
Exceptional
43 reviews
Price from
US$20
per night

Owl's Nest Chalet is located in Udawalawe. Providing complimentary private parking, the apartment is 15 km from Udawalawe National Park. Outdoor seating is also available at Owl's Nest Chalet.

This apartment includes 2 bedrooms, a living room and a TV, an equipped kitchen with a dining area, and 1 bathroom with a walk-in shower. For added convenience, the property can provide towels and linens for a supplement. For added privacy, the accommodation features a private entrance. It is in a great location and beautiful accommodation. very helpful and friendly host.

Show more Show less
9.8
Exceptional
6 reviews
Price from
US$13.40
per night

Located in Belihul Oya, Eagle Wings Holiday provides accommodation with free WiFi, air conditioning and access to a garden. The accommodation features a sauna.

The lodge provides guests with a terrace, mountain views, a seating area, a flat-screen TV, a fully equipped kitchen with a fridge and an oven, and a private bathroom with bidet and free toiletries. A toaster and kettle are also provided. The staff were nice and they were really reactive whenever we needed something. Perfect stay ! I recommend without any hesitation :) Thank you for the warm welcome

Show more Show less
9
Superb
5 reviews
Price from
US$45
per night

Most booked cabins in Ratnapura District this month

FAQs about cabins in Ratnapura District

Cabins that guests love in Ratnapura District